The U's integrate with the rock sliders. Install will take some modification for those universal steps. I have a pair of U's but I would never sell them. I keep them as spares in case one of mine is broken on a rock or whatever. They used to go for $100/step but now the prices are a joke.......LE's never pulled a premium like U's did because LE's were much more plentiful but as mentioned you will also need the lower rocker panel for LE's to work.
